Meaning, origin, history
Alvah is a name of Hebrew origin, meaning "other" or "ascending." It is not a particularly common name, but it has been used in various forms throughout history.
The name Alvah is believed to have originated from the Hebrew name Alvay, which means "other" or "different." The name may also be associated with the biblical figure of Alvah, who was one of the sons of Seir and a chieftain of the Horites. However, it is important to note that there is no direct evidence linking the modern name Alvah to these historical figures.
The name Alvah has been used in various forms throughout history. In the 19th century, it was used as a given name for both boys and girls in the United States. Today, however, it is primarily used as a masculine given name.
Overall, while not particularly common, the name Alvah has an interesting Hebrew origin and meaning, making it a unique choice for parents looking for a distinctive name for their child.
